区块链视角下的网站构建:框架选型与设计原则融合
|
区块链并非万能胶,不能简单地给传统网站“贴上”去中心化标签。真正的融合始于对问题本质的审视:当网站需要不可篡改的日志审计、跨组织的数据协同验证、用户主权身份管理,或需规避单点故障与平台封禁风险时,区块链才成为值得引入的技术层。此时,它不是替代HTTP或HTML,而是作为可信计算与状态共识的增强模块嵌入整体架构。 框架选型必须遵循“最小必要”原则。前端可沿用React或Vue,但需集成轻量级钱包SDK(如Web3Modal、RainbowKit),使用户能安全签名而非托管私钥;后端避免全链上存储——将大文件哈希上链、原始数据存IPFS或去中心化存储网络(如Filecoin),既保障完整性又兼顾性能;智能合约仅承载核心业务逻辑(如通证发放规则、多签审批流),复杂计算仍交由链下服务处理,并通过零知识证明或乐观验证机制锚定结果可信性。 设计原则上,“用户即节点”是根本转向。网站不再默认拥有用户数据控制权,而是提供本地密钥管理工具,让用户自主选择将哪些凭证(如学历、信用分)以可验证凭证(VC)形式发布至分布式标识符(DID)系统。登录不再依赖密码与第三方OAuth,而是通过DID签名完成身份声明,网站仅校验签名有效性与凭证颁发者信誉,不接触原始敏感信息。
AI生成内容图,仅供参考 可扩展性与用户体验不可割裂。链上交易延迟与Gas费波动是现实约束,因此采用分层设计:高频交互(如评论点赞)走状态通道或链下聚合签名,周期性批量上链;关键操作(如资产转移、合同签署)才触发链上确认。同时,默认启用账户抽象(AA)钱包,让用户以邮箱或社交账号为入口,底层自动处理Gas代付与多签策略,使区块链的复杂性对普通用户完全透明。 安全边界需重新定义。传统WAF与防火墙依然必要,但新增维度在于合约审计、预言机输入验证及链间桥接风险管控。所有链上地址必须经多重签名或时间锁保护;外部数据源(如价格、天气)须通过去中心化预言机网络(如Chainlink)聚合,杜绝单点操纵;跨链功能若非必需则暂缓上线,优先确保主网生态的健壮性。 最终,成功的融合不是技术堆砌,而是价值对齐。当网站构建者放弃“掌控一切”的幻觉,转而设计激励相容的协作规则——例如用通证奖励内容审核者、用链上投票决定功能迭代方向——技术才真正服务于信任共建。区块链在此过程中,退为沉默的公证人,而人与人之间的协议,成为网站最坚固的底层架构。 (编辑:云计算网_梅州站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330479号